UserSplit Cutover Drift: the extracted account service and the legacy Marigold monolith user module are reporting divergent record counts during dual-write. This fires when drift exceeds 0.5% over 15 minutes. New team members should not replay writes manually. Reconciliation steps and the rollback procedure are documented on the internal page.

wiki page, tajog-fafog: https://gitlab.paliqsys.corp/dash/display/job/853dd6fcbf54

## Releases

For the weekly sync: the autocomplete index rebuild in Quillseeker v1.9 remains slow (roughly 40 minutes on the Dunmarsh shard), so release artifacts are cut after the nightly rebuild completes. Tag the release, let the Bramblewood runner produce the signed bundle, and verify before promotion. Verification fails if your local trust store lacks the current release identity, which rotated last month. To save you a lookup, the active release signing key follows here.

release key, fajef-kajeg: bky19_LdLu6Ne6FLi8he2c24d

Handover: Ratewell tax-rate lookup cache (from Dorin to Maeska's team). The cache shards by jurisdiction code and refreshes nightly from the Quillbury rates feed. Watch the eviction metric — anything above 5% usually means the feed schema drifted. Invalidation scripts live in the ops repo under /ratewell/cache; run them only after confirming the feed checksum. New members should also note the cold-start vault: unsealing it after a full flush requires the recovery passphrase, which is:

unlock words, kajef-kadug: sorys-pelax-lamael-tamvan-briiel-novdor-fenwyn-tamdor-oliion-keleth-julok-belion-ralok

Handover — stale-cache postmortem (Cindergate)

New folks: the Varn cache served stale pricing for six hours in March. Postmortem doc lives in the Cindergate archive; fixes shipped, TTL invalidation now event-driven. One follow-up remains: rotate the archive lock. The archive is sealed; read access needs the recovery passphrase, appended below.

strongbox words: sorir-belvan-rusix-ulays-ralmir-praix-eliir-tamax-praael-druael-julir-tamius-jorir